Block 2650591

0xaa46345918709d31cf94e5ee30c67251e813ddd7d7206b682e76f9215bd27763
Transactions4
Height2650591
Confirmations18375501
TimestampFri, 18 Nov 2016 13:52:40 UTC
Size (bytes)1529
Version
Merkle Root
Nonce0xaa9141600124a497
Bits
Difficulty0x5bf5127a5f8

Transactions

Fee: 0.00042 ETC
18375501 Confirmations1.1123401159694918 ETC
Fee: 0.00042 ETC
18375501 Confirmations10.053354051684948 ETC
Fee: 0.00042 ETC
18375501 Confirmations1.0323121125192707 ETC